In an unexpected move, Microsoft has announced an extension for its Windows 10 free security updates, now available to users until October 2027. This decision is particularly relevant as the tech giant seeks to assist users in maintaining their systems without incurring additional costs amidst a climate of rising cybersecurity threats. Here’s what you need to know about this development and why it matters now.

How to Access Free Updates
For Windows 10 users, accessing these free security updates is straightforward. Here’s a simple guide on how to ensure your system is up to date:
Step-by-Step Guide:
- Open Settings on your Windows 10 device.
- Click on Update & Security.
- Select Windows Update and check for updates.
- Install any available updates to ensure your system is protected.

The Impact on Users and Businesses
For many individual users and small businesses, the financial implications of maintaining up-to-date software can be significant. By providing free updates until 2027, Microsoft alleviates the potential burden of a $30 fee that would have applied to users outside the extended support. This action is particularly crucial as numerous businesses continue to navigate the challenges of a post-pandemic world, where every cost-saving measure counts.
